Date: Fri, 12 May 2000 20:07:27 -0400 Reply-To: Maryland Birds & Birding Sender: Maryland Birds & Birding From: Andy Rabin Subject: Wilson's Warbler @ SCSP MIME-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set="iso-8859-1" Content-Transfer-Encoding: 7bit Generally a slower morning at Seneca Creek State Park, but I did manage t= o watch a WILSON'S WARBLER for a few minutes. It was in the shrubs that border the far left corner of the field across the street from the playground. I also saw some crows mobbing a GREAT HORNED OWL near the s= ame location. Along Great Seneca Trail there were several singing and/or visible SWAINSON'S THRUSHES.
